
Benzene News"Health Hazards Near Wells" June 23, 2008 According to reports, a study which was conducted over a two-year period found that people who live near oil and gas operations are at a higher risk of health problems. Researchers found that exposure to benzene, a known carcinogen, was the most common hazard among those who lived near gas facilities. Study Reveals Risks The study revealed that those who live farther from gas operations are less likely to be exposed to benzene and other harmful toxins. Teresa Coons, a senior scientist for the Saccomanno Research Institute was one of the lead researchers on the study. Russell Walker, who also worked on the study, claimed they found the benzene exposure could be significant up to a hundred of yards from the gas operations. Using Technology to Regulate Benzene Emissions Walker says that if technologies are used towards this cause, benzene could be reduced by an estimated 90 percent.
